The fact they are willing to work with other developers and open up their driver source code to allow developing custom applications makes them one of a kind for the money they are charging.
At the price of the obdx you can split the tuning industry into 3 segments with it remaining profitable for all 3.
Hardware with low level software drivers (J2534, gmlan etc) eg obdx
Tuning software/mapping/custom roms (eg what we do at PCMTEC)
Tuning itself, eg the tuning workshops that do the hard work of finding customers and making their cars work by doing custom tuning.
This means each segment can specialise instead of spreading themselves thin and doing each one at an average level.

MAUI template app is now also going to support direct USB connection on Android devices!
The default android USB CDC driver works with OBDX devices, this will easily be the fastest option available which we will encourage developers to use.
Unfortunately it is not an option for iPhones, but still pushing forward with solutions there.

I have been trying to get a Ford AU Falcon (Aussie Ford) EEC-V ECU to be communicating on the bench using PWM. I know its powered up, since its outputting the reference 5v on the PWM negative line, but it just never broadcasts any information and does not respond to any diagnostic requests.
I have attached a photo which has the 104 connector pinout and highlighted the pins of interest. I do not have FEPs connected, but it does not seem to make a difference.
Currently the method of testing out PWM is basically having a J2534 tool connected and sending a PWM message so that our tools can decode to verify its timing is correct. Then sending back a message and verifying the J2534 tool picks it up. I have to have the AU ECU connected since it provides the 5v pullup on the PWM negative line which is needed for communication. This kind of development works but is not ideal, would much rather real life ECU responses, traffic, noise ect which then allows us to use dealership tools for testing out the J2534 compliance.
If anyone spots something I might have missed on that sheet, do let me know!

Im not sure if there’s some specific command I suppose to send to the ecu to start a diagnostic session?
There’s next to zero information online about the AU falcon ecus in regards to diagnostics. Basically everything online is relating to tuning and links to the xcal3.
Iv sent a few questions out to a few gurus, hopefully someone has the answer. Or has a bench ecu+harness that’s known to be working to purchase.
Pwm also has a high speed mode (83.2kbps) used for programming, this is the part I want to ensure is rock solid which requires careful timing.
